pacmanVersionGE('3.20') package('http://vdt.cs.wisc.edu/vdt_1101_cache:VDT-Common') package('http://vdt.cs.wisc.edu/vdt_1101_cache:Condor-Questions') download('http://vdt.cs.wisc.edu/software/privacy/1.10.1/privacy-Condor.txt') shell('mkdir -p post-install; cat privacy-Condor.txt >> post-install/PRIVACY; rm privacy-Condor.txt') description('Condor & Condor-G') url('http://vdt.cs.wisc.edu/components/condor.html') package('http://vdt.cs.wisc.edu/vdt_1101_cache:Condor-Environment') { envIsSet('VDTSETUP_CONDOR_LOCATION'); { true() OR fail('Pacman install failed') } OR { package('http://vdt.cs.wisc.edu/vdt_1101_cache:Licenses'); package('http://vdt.cs.wisc.edu/vdt_1101_cache:JDK-1.5'); { processor('ia64'); { package('http://vdt.cs.wisc.edu/vdt_1101_cache:JDK-1.4') OR fail('Pacman install failed') } OR { true() OR fail('Pacman install failed') } }; package('http://vdt.cs.wisc.edu/vdt_1101_cache:Globus-Base-Essentials'); package('http://vdt.cs.wisc.edu/vdt_1101_cache:Configure-Condor'); { platform('linux-rhel-4'); { processor('i686') OR envIsSet('VDT_PRETEND_32') }; {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('darwin'); { processor('i386') OR envIsSet('VDT_PRETEND_32') }; {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_macos_10.4.tar.gz') OR fail('Pacman install failed') } OR platform('linux-debian-4'); { processor('i686') OR envIsSet('VDT_PRETEND_32') }; {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_deb_4.0.tar.gz') OR fail('Pacman install failed') } OR platform('linux-suse-9'); { processor('i686') OR envIsSet('VDT_PRETEND_32') }; {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-rhel-3'); { processor('i686') OR envIsSet('VDT_PRETEND_32') }; {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-sl-fermi-3.0'); { processor('i686') OR envIsSet('VDT_PRETEND_32') }; {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-rocks-3.3'); { processor('i686') OR envIsSet('VDT_PRETEND_32') }; {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-rhel-5'); { processor('i686') OR envIsSet('VDT_PRETEND_32') }; {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_rhap_5.tar.gz') OR fail('Pacman install failed') } OR platform('linux-debian-3.1'); { processor('i686') OR envIsSet('VDT_PRETEND_32') }; {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-sl-fermi-4.0'); { processor('i686') OR envIsSet('VDT_PRETEND_32') }; {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-rhel-4'); processor('x86_64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_64_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-debian-4'); processor('x86_64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_64_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-suse-9'); processor('x86_64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_64_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-rhel-3'); processor('x86_64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_64_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-sl-fermi-3.0'); processor('x86_64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_64_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-rocks-3.3'); processor('x86_64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_64_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-rhel-5'); processor('x86_64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_64_rhap_5.tar.gz') OR fail('Pacman install failed') } OR platform('linux-debian-3.1'); processor('x86_64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_64_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-sl-fermi-4.0'); processor('x86_64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.x86_64_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-rhel-4'); processor('ia64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.ia64_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-debian-4'); processor('ia64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.ia64_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-suse-9'); processor('ia64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.ia64_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-rhel-3'); processor('ia64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.ia64_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-sl-fermi-3.0'); processor('ia64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.ia64_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-rocks-3.3'); processor('ia64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.ia64_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-rhel-5'); processor('ia64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.ia64_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-debian-3.1'); processor('ia64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.ia64_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('linux-sl-fermi-4.0'); processor('ia64'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.ia64_rhas_3.tar.gz') OR fail('Pacman install failed') } OR platform('AIX5'); { download('http://vdt.cs.wisc.edu/software//condor-2/7.0.5/condor-7.0.5.ppc_aix_5.3.tar.gz') OR fail('Pacman install failed') } OR { fail('No download for your platform') OR fail('Pacman install failed') } }; shell('vdt-begin-install Condor'); shell('vdt-untar condor-7.0.5* condor'); shell('. $VDT_LOCATION/vdt-questions.sh; . $VDT_LOCATION/vdt/etc/condor-env.sh; vdt/setup/configure_condor --install --maybe-daemon-owner --make-personal-condor --install-log ../post-install/README'); shell('echo "Condor Local config file: " >> vdt-install.log'); shell('cat condor/local.*/condor_config.local >> vdt-install.log'); shell('echo "" >> vdt-install.log'); shell('vdt/bin/vdt-version --add CONDOR --short-version "7.0.5"'); shell('vdt-end-install') OR fail('Pacman install failed') } } uninstallShell('vdt/sbin/vdt-uninstall Condor') uninstallShell('vdt/bin/vdt-version -remove CONDOR')